diff options
| author | Paul Eggert | 2011-06-05 23:10:06 -0700 |
|---|---|---|
| committer | Paul Eggert | 2011-06-05 23:10:06 -0700 |
| commit | dd52fcea063f37a9875bf9196dbe11a442e8adfc (patch) | |
| tree | 63f3c4a06456cdc3f025a0b4b4089f7be42108ec /src/ChangeLog | |
| parent | 7f9bbdbbd60a3c9052537cd4b65a3a6d959b7746 (diff) | |
| download | emacs-dd52fcea063f37a9875bf9196dbe11a442e8adfc.tar.gz emacs-dd52fcea063f37a9875bf9196dbe11a442e8adfc.zip | |
* image.c: Use ptrdiff_t, not int, for sizes.
(slurp_file): Switch from int to ptrdiff_t.
All uses changed.
(slurp_file): Check that file size fits in both size_t (for
malloc) and ptrdiff_t (for sanity and safety).
Diffstat (limited to 'src/ChangeLog')
| -rw-r--r-- | src/ChangeLog |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/src/ChangeLog b/src/ChangeLog index f86b0decf3c..7fb1479e548 100644 --- a/src/ChangeLog +++ b/src/ChangeLog | |||
| @@ -1,5 +1,11 @@ | |||
| 1 | 2011-06-06 Paul Eggert <eggert@cs.ucla.edu> | 1 | 2011-06-06 Paul Eggert <eggert@cs.ucla.edu> |
| 2 | 2 | ||
| 3 | * image.c: Use ptrdiff_t, not int, for sizes. | ||
| 4 | (slurp_file): Switch from int to ptrdiff_t. | ||
| 5 | All uses changed. | ||
| 6 | (slurp_file): Check that file size fits in both size_t (for | ||
| 7 | malloc) and ptrdiff_t (for sanity and safety). | ||
| 8 | |||
| 3 | * fileio.c (Fverify_visited_file_modtime): Avoid time overflow | 9 | * fileio.c (Fverify_visited_file_modtime): Avoid time overflow |
| 4 | if b->modtime has its maximal value. | 10 | if b->modtime has its maximal value. |
| 5 | 11 | ||